Sample Organism: Human herpesvirus 4, Homo sapiens, Human herpesvirus 4
Sample: Epstein-Barr virus glycoproteins H,L,42 in complex with the human antibody Fab fragment AMMO1.
Fitted models: 6c5v

Deposition Authors: Snijder J, Ortego MS, Weidle C, Stuart AB, Gray MA, McElrath MJ, Pancera M, Veesler D, McGuire AT, Seattle Structural Genomics Center for Infectious Disease (SSGCID)
An Antibody Targeting the Fusion Machinery Neutralizes Dual-Tropic Infection and Defines a Site of Vulnerability on Epstein-Barr Virus.
Snijder J, Ortego MS, Weidle C, Stuart AB, Gray MD, McElrath MJ, Pancera M, Veesler D, McGuire AT
(2018) Immunity , 48 , 799 - 811.e9
PUBMED: 29669253
DOI: doi:10.1016/j.immuni.2018.03.026
